INITIAL OPERATING
Mounting of the machine
The machine should be mounted with turning wheels
and rear axle with rear wheels. The turning wheels
can be mounted without opening the machine. Use
either a ring spanner or a small wheel spanner.
Mains supply
The machine is designed for 230V (220-240V) and
must not be connected to other voltages.
Gas connection
The mashine is designed for use of a 6/10 kg gas
bottle with a maximum height of 100 cm. Larger
bottles must not be used due to risk of overloading
the machine or the machine will overturn.

CONTROL SWITCHES
1
6
2
3
4
5
1. On
Lights when the machine has been turned on.
2. Overheating
Lights if the welding process is automatically
stopped due to overheating of the transformer.
The light extinguishes when the transformer
temperature has dropped to normal, and weld-
ing can continue.
3.
Wire feed speed control
Infinitely variable (1.0 - 10 m/min).
4. Main switch and switch for welding voltage
5. Connection of welding hose
6. Fuse
1 A slow.
